Japanese investors return to overseas bonds as stronger yen, higher yields boost demand<br>ETMarkets.com

Japanese investors were net buyers of foreign bonds for the first time in three weeks, as a stronger yen following U.S.-Japan intervention and elevated overseas yields supported demand.

Japanese investors bought a net 477.9 billion yen ($3.03 billion) in foreign long-term bonds ‌in ⁠the week ⁠ended August 1 as well as a net 424.7 billion ​yen in short-term bills in their first weekly net purchases since ​July 11, data from Japan's Ministry of Finance showed.

The yen's roughly 3.98% rise against the U.S. dollar ​last week boosted Japanese investors' purchasing power. ⁠The currency gained ‌after Japanese and U.S. authorities ​intervened in currency ​markets, following its slide to a ⁠40-year low in the previous week.

Japanese investors have ​sold a net 2.84 trillion yen in foreign ​long-term bonds so far this year, despite last week's buying, compared with 9.57 trillion yen in net purchases over the same period last year.

Japanese investors, meanwhile, divested a net 276.4 billion yen from ‌foreign stocks, nearly reversing net purchases of 289.1 billion yen in the prior week.

At the ​same time, ​foreign investors ⁠bought a net 558.9 billion yen of Japanese long-term bonds-their first weekly net purchase since July 11. Japanese short-term bills, ​however, recorded a fourth consecutive weekly outflow of 292.9 billion yen.

Foreign investors withdrew a net 392.5 billion yen from Japanese stocks, following net purchases of 912.4 billion yen in the prior week.
